Oracle数据恢复失败:常见原因及对策
在Oracle数据库的恢复过程中,如果出现失败的情况,可以总结出一些常见原因,并针对性地制定对策。以下是一些常见的原因和对策:
错误的操作:
- 冲突备份:新的备份文件可能会覆盖旧的备份,导致数据损坏。
错误的恢复步骤:按照错误的方式执行恢复操作,可能导致数据库未完全恢复。
对策:在进行任何备份或恢复操作前,确保理解其目的和正确的步骤。使用Oracle的官方工具和文档。
硬件故障:
- 硬盘损坏或丢失数据。
主存储器(内存)问题导致数据无法读取。
对策:定期检查硬件设备,如硬盘、内存等,并确保它们处于良好的工作状态。备份重要的数据。
数据库损坏:
- 由于系统崩溃或其他原因导致数据库未正确关闭。
数据库日志丢失或损坏,导致事务无法提交到持久化层。
对策:在应用程序正常关闭时,确保数据库正确关闭。对于日志文件,应定期备份并检查完整性。如果必要,可以使用Oracle的
RECOVER DATABASE
命令来恢复损坏的数据库。
总之,针对Oracle数据恢复失败的情况,我们需要深入了解问题所在,并采取相应的预防措施和解决策略。
还没有评论,来说两句吧...